Transaction 62a57d3d9c3a305413c7e844130c268b49a23a1efdcad760aa6ac24fdc265c3c

8 Input
2 Outputs
  • 62a57d3d9c3a305413c7e844130c268b49a23a1efdcad760aa6ac24fdc265c3c:0
  • value  23651
    address  1LhY2pDiwgeNrynu73DCjmSgt3bJPRHBSh
  • 62a57d3d9c3a305413c7e844130c268b49a23a1efdcad760aa6ac24fdc265c3c:1
  • value  300000
    address  35uCYftZyUHeghEeKoPFzidH6s7BFVamFx